DIY Shine Jar:

Let’s make a Shine Jar! You’ll need a clear jar, glow-in-the-dark paint, and stickers. Decorate your jar with the paint and stickers. Each time you do something kind or help someone, write it on a small piece of paper and put it in the jar. Watch how your Shine Jar glows in the dark, just like your good deeds light up the world!
